Peculiarities

Contrary to its seeming simplicity, a do-it-yourself highchair is not an easy task to complete without any preparation. Do not start work until you have a clear understanding of how the end result should look like, and what operations will have to be performed to achieve this.

Also, don't ignore the calculations. Any chair should be strong enough to withstand its “passenger”, and the child, although not heavy, will not sit neatly on it, especially since the dimensions of such furniture are also small.

Strength requirements are relevant not only for basic materials, but also for fasteners, be it self-tapping screws, glue or grooves. In addition, the baby is constantly growing, and it makes sense to make a high chair with a margin of at least a couple of years in advance. For all its strength, the product should be comfortable, that is, approximately correspond to the dimensions of the owner.

Also try to ensure the proper lightness of the furniture being made - it should be convenient for the owner to independently move his chair to where he wants to sit at the moment.

Don't forget to stay safe. Furniture, in any case, cannot be traumatic, and children's furniture even more so. No sharp edges are allowed, and if wood is the main material, as happens in most cases, then it must be carefully sanded to avoid peeling splinters. covering ready product varnish or paint, give preference to natural - children tend to put everything in their mouths, and can be poisoned by a toxic coating.

Finally, remember that this chair is for a child. In addition to suitable sizes, it is also desirable for a piece of furniture to be beautiful. If complex decor is not for you, try to at least paint it in bright colors.

materials

In terms of ease of processing and environmental friendliness among the materials for the manufacture of children's furniture, wood and its derivatives undoubtedly hold the palm. Therefore, most often you can find a wooden chair. However, you can not choose any tree - here, too, it is worth considering before proceeding with the manufacture. The most popular among all types of wood is beech. They have a strength reminiscent of oak, but are easier to work with and less expensive. In general, exactly hardwoods are considered a priority. Of the inexpensive options, birch is often chosen, you can also consider linden.

from wood conifers spruce and pine are suitable for making furniture, but the resin contained in any such wood is dangerous - it can stain clothes, and it can also pose a health hazard. Regardless of the specific species, choose a homogeneous tree, without knots and cracks, with an even texture.

The material of the seat may be similar to the material of the body, or it may be fundamentally different. In order to save money and achieve greater flexibility, the seat is also made from plywood, and even from chipboard. When choosing them, give preference to only the most durable types, but remember that in any case they are inferior in terms of durability to solid natural wood.

For increased softness, the seat can be additionally equipped with a small foam cushion, sheathed with a fabric that is pleasant to the touch.

For the youngest children

The youngest children so far sit on the highchair for only one thing - eating. It is important and necessary to teach a child to eat while sitting, and indeed to sit, in particular, at the table. However, the features of its development in this stage do not allow the use of ordinary chairs for this. The problem lies in the fact that a simple chair does not have a back with handles, and a tiny child himself will not be able to sit on it evenly, and will simply fall.

As for highchairs, their dimensions usually do not allow you to choose a normal table for them. In this situation, a special highchair for feeding will be an excellent way out.

Such furniture should be comfortable for both the child and his mother - so far the child cannot eat on his own, so the mother will have to spoon-feed him. For the convenience of this operation, the chair is made at a normal height, or even a little higher - so that the mother does not bend over. The actual period of use of such a chair is about a year, so if you have one child and the family does not plan a second one at all, you can choose not the most durable materials for manufacturing.

In terms of manufacturing, the highchair is perhaps the most complex - it has the largest number of parts. The relatively small seat is raised high above the floor, which makes it necessary to resort to installing additional stiffeners between the legs - for improved structural stability.

Given the specifics of the child of the appropriate age, both the backrest and the railing are simply necessary - they must completely exclude the possibility of the baby falling. Moreover, the barrier must also be in front, although it has another useful feature- it plays the role of a countertop on which food will be placed. The space under the tabletop is left free - the baby will stick his legs in there.

Cutting and assembling such a chair is quite simple. First, according to the drawing, two identical side halves are cut out, which are then interconnected by the seat, backrest and stiffeners using grooves, glue or self-tapping screws. Before assembly, all individual parts should be sanded to a perfectly smooth state, the finished product is varnished or painted - ready.

We print them like a regular multi-page document on A4 sheets. At the same time, in the Acrobat Reader print wizard, it is important not to forget to specify the "Actual size" scale. As a result, after gluing individual sheets, we get a drawing of the part on a scale of 1: 1.

We cut out the drawing of the racks along the contour and paste it on a sheet of plywood.

Plywood 22 mm thick was chosen as the material for the racks. Cut out the first part, stepping back from the contour of 5 mm. In general, the quality and accuracy of the cut is not very important. If only there was some reserve.

Now the resulting rough edges of the workpiece must be aligned exactly according to the drawing. I usually use the term "comb" to refer to this action. To do this, we press a flat rail to the workpiece along the line of the drawing and pass along the edge with a copy cutter with an upper bearing. The roundings were processed by guiding the milling cutter by hand, followed by the adjustment of the roundings grinder. You can spend more time on this blank, because. it will serve as a template and the quality of the rest of the racks depends on the quality of its processing.

Now, having a template, we mark and cut out the rest of the blanks for the racks

Next, using self-tapping screws, we fix the template on the blanks. To tighten the screws in the template, we make holes in those places where there will be holes for attaching the seat and footrest. In this case, the head of the twisted self-tapping screw should not protrude from the template.

And with the help copy cutter align the edges of the workpiece according to the template.

Using a milling cutter inserted into the table, we make a groove in which the elements fixing the seat and footrest will move. For simplicity, I decided to call them runners. The depth of the groove is 10 mm, the width of the groove is 24 mm (maybe it would be more convenient to make the width of the groove equal to the width of the existing plywood - 22 mm, but there was no such cutter in the workshop).

In the middle of the groove, we make holes at equal distances. WITH reverse side workpieces at the exit point of the drill, it is necessary to put a bar so that the drill does not break out the lower layer of veneer. It will be extremely difficult to close or mask such a chip.

We do the same with runners. We print the drawing in real size, cut it out and paste it on a plywood sheet. Next, cut out with a margin and "comb" as we did with the stand template.

From the same sheet of plywood 22 mm with a jigsaw, roughly cut out future runners with a margin.

With the same screws we fix the template on the workpiece

And on milling table using a copy cutter, we align the edges of the blanks according to the template.

Using an edge molding cutter, we round the edges on all the resulting parts. Rounding radius 4.8 mm.

Next, a rail is cut out, with the help of which the runners engage with the chute on the uprights. Rail height 20 mm, width 24 mm. Because I didn’t have either 20 mm or 24 mm plywood, it was decided to make the rail from massive ash. This wood has excellent strength characteristics.

A corresponding groove was made in the runners on the milling table and the slats were glued into it. At the same time, when you make a gutter, you must not forget that the runners are right and left.

After the glue dries, the slats are sawn and ground flush with the body of the runners. Also, holes are made in the runners for fixing them on the racks.

Also in the runners, grooves are milled parallel to the floor. Gutter depth 10 mm, width 16 mm. Seats and footrests will be fixed in these gutters. In the next photo you can see the finished runners.

We do the same with the seat and footrest templates: we print the drawing, glue it on plywood and cut out the blank.

In order to make even roundings, I used a thin rail of 5 mm plywood, passed between the self-tapping screws that set the desired radius. She bends well and creates smooth transitions. How it is done can be seen in the photo:

As a result, we get two templates - footrests (left) and seats (right). Next, we work with them according to an already worked out scheme - we mark the blanks (circle the templates with a pencil) and cut them out using a jigsaw with an indent of 5 mm. 16 mm plywood was used for them, although 22 mm is also possible. We fix the template on the workpiece with self-tapping screws and work out the edges with a copy cutter. With ready-made templates, the whole operation takes a few minutes. The small holes left on the finished parts from self-tapping screws can either be simply ignored due to their small size, or hidden with putty at the grinding stage. Personally, I went the first way. Don't forget to round off the edges with an edge cutter.

The template for the back did "in place". Therefore, there is no drawing of the back. I made the top and bottom edges according to the seat template. Backrest height 100 mm, Width 464 mm (depth of the groove for the backrest in the uprights 10 mm). After the template is ready, we make a couple of backs on it using an electric jigsaw and a copy cutter in a few minutes.

There are three crossbars in the chair. They are made from the same 22 mm sheet. The dimensions of the crossbars that fix the runners are 399x50x22 mm. The lower crossbar (in the lower part near the floor) - 444x30x22 mm. Using a 10 mm straight cutter, we make grooves for countersunk furniture nuts - barrels.

Next, we make a groove for the backrest. The angle of the backrest was chosen in accordance with GOST 19301.2-94. "Children's preschool furniture ..." The angle of inclination of the back along it is at least 5 degrees or more. My chair has an angle of 11 degrees - I find it a very comfortable angle.

We get a small pile of details

Each chair is assembled on hexagon bolts and furniture countersunk barrel nuts. Bolts have dimensions 6x70 and 6x50, nuts - 10x20 and 10x12. The mounting kit is shown in the photo.

Ready. As they say, "it seems to be true." During assembly, the quality of workmanship and fitting of parts is checked, minor flaws are eliminated, and “finishing with a file” is carried out. At this sawing-drilling-milling stage is completed.

The sanding and painting phase begins. Now the chairs are completely disassembled and all parts are sanded before coating. I used paper 180. In some places I had to fiddle with 80 and even 40.

If, after applying the first layer of varnish, the color lay unevenly, the details are covered with bald spots due to varying degrees of absorption, the pile has risen and the surface has become like sandpaper, and in general it all looks terrible and you want to quit everything, then you are on the right track. After the first layer has dried (after three or four hours), we take sandpaper with a grain size of 180 and grind all the raised pile. Next, we put the second layer, after which the surface became a little better after drying - there is no pile and the color is smoother, but still far from the picture on the label of the varnish can. Therefore, we matte the details with the same sandpaper and put the third layer. Behind him is a fourth. And so on. Continue until you are satisfied with the result. Five layers were enough for me, for which two days were spent.

Step one: dimensioning the plywood


For the manufacture of our chair, we will use 9 mm thick plywood, and for one chair we only need to take a piece of plywood measuring 640 mm x 570 mm. I used 9mm plywood, but if you have 8mm or 10mm plywood, that will work too, just need to change some dimensions in the drawings (you need to change the width of all the eyelets on the back, seat and legs, to the width of the plywood you are using ). To begin with, we transfer all the dimensions of the drawing to a sheet of plywood.

Step two: cut out the details from plywood


After dimensioning the plywood using one of the above methods, you can start cutting out our parts. Most available tool which we will use is, of course, a jigsaw. You can use a manual jigsaw, such as children use at school in labor lessons, or a more advanced electric jigsaw. After cutting, we should get these details.


There is also an easier way to get our parts, and this way can be used by those who have a CNC machine or have access to it. Download the same file above, open it in the Compass 3D program, and save it in the required format for software CNC machine. Now our parts will be cut out in a matter of minutes.

Step Three: Preparing Parts for Assembly


Before proceeding with the assembly of the chair, all parts must be properly sanded. We take sandpaper No. 100, and we go through all the surfaces of the parts from all sides, we also knock down sharp edges. It is necessary to check all the connections of the parts, whether everything is connected well, and if you need to immediately adjust the joints to each other. After that, we take sandpaper No. 240, and again we pass along all surfaces of the parts from all sides.

Step four: assembling the chair


After preparing all the details and checking the tightness of the joints, you can begin to assemble the chair. We take two drawers and smear the joints with glue, after which we connect them with the legs of the chair.






Next, we glue the legs at the joints with glue and glue the seat, we fasten the back in the same way.







We wipe the glue that came out with a damp cloth, and leave the chair for a day in a warm place.

Step five: painting the chair


The final step in the manufacture of the chair will be its painting. Walk before painting sandpaper No. 240 in the places of gluing, and so go over the entire chair. As an example, consider how to make a folding chair according to the proposed project, which will be useful to every summer resident or fisherman. This design quite simple, the only thing before you start manufacturing, you should make drawings of a folding plywood chair with your own hands on a one-to-one scale on millimeter paper.

As a material for the product, you will need a sheet of moisture-resistant plywood 2 cm thick. Its length and width should be at least 600x900 mm.

Manufacturing procedure

So, the instructions for making a folding plywood chair are as follows:

  • first of all, you need to fix the prepared drawings of a folding plywood chair with your own hands on a sheet of cardboard and cut out the detail templates with scissors;
  • then the templates need to be attached to a sheet of plywood and circled with a pencil;
  • Next, you need to cut the parts along the marked lines with an electric jigsaw. To cut out parts of the structure inside plywood sheet, you must first drill a hole;
  • sawn parts must be sanded. If necessary, the cut lines should be trimmed;
  • then, according to the drawing, you need to make holes for the hinges. As the latter, you can use bolts with sleeves. To firmly fix the sleeves in the blind holes of the parts, they can be glued with epoxy glue.

  • after that, in detail No. 3, it is necessary to cut holes for the fangs with a Forster drill;
  • now all structural elements need to be laid on flat surface and collect.

Now that the folding chair is ready, it must be varnished. To give the ends an attractive look, they can be glued with veneer.
